The
team
of
Nagarjuna"s
latest
Telugu
movie
has
announced
the
final
title
of
the
film
in
a
media
briefing
in
Hyderabad.
They
have
settled
on
Gaganam
as
the
title
of
the
movie.
Radha
Mohan
is
directing
the
movie,
which
is
being
produced
by
Dil
Raju
under
the
banner
of
Sri
Venkateswara
Creations.
The
movie
also
has
a
Tamil
version,
which
has
been
produced
by
Prakash
Raj.
The
title
Gaganam
has
been
chosen
based
on
the
audience
reaction.
Payanam
and
Wanted
are
the
two
other
names,
which
were
also
considered
as
a
title
of
the
movie.
Payanam
has
been
chosen
as
the
title
of
the
Tamil
version
of
the
movie.
The
lead
actor
Nagarjuna,
Prakash
Raj,
director
Dil
Raju,
Brahmanandam,
Bharath
Reddy,
Poonam
Kaur,
Sana
Khan,
and
Rishi
were
present
at
the
media
briefing.
Actor
Nagarjuna
informed
that
the
movie
is
a
complete
entertainer
although
the
still
and
the
title
looks
like
a
thriller.
He
said,
“The
title
is
liked
by
his
younger
son
Akhil
and
he
posted
about
it
on
his
Twitter
account.
The
audience
also
gave
most
response
to
this
title".
The
movie
has
reportedly
used
the
latest
technological
addition
in
the
filmmaking,
the
RED
cameras.
The
camera
is
handled
by
cinematographer
Guhan.
The
post-production
work
of
the
movie
is
going
on
and
dubbing
is
almost
complete.
The
director
is
planning
to
have
a
Vijaya
Dasami
release
of
the
movie
in
October.
